随着互联网的发展,数据已经成为了当今社会的一种重要资源。在信息化时代,企业和个人都需要从各种数据源中获取有效的信息来指导决策和提升业务。而微信公众号作为一个广泛应用的社交平台,为企业和个人提供了一个重要的渠道,通过发布文章、活动等形式与用户进行沟通和交流。
然而,微信公众号默认情况下只能使用微信的相关功能,不能直接获取或使用外部数据。但是,对于一些需要获取外部数据的场景,可以通过一些方法实现微信公众号与外部数据源的接入,从而拓展其功能和应用范围。
下面将介绍三种常见的微信公众号接入外部数据源的方法。
一、利用开放接口
1.1 第三方平台
微信提供了第三方平台功能,通过该功能,可以将微信公众号与自己的服务器进行对接,实现数据交互。在微信公众号平台上注册并成为第三方开发者后,可以使用开放接口提供的功能来获取用户信息、发送模板消息等。同时,第三方平台还可以通过接口获取微信公众号的用户数据和粉丝数据,实现数据的统计和分析。
1.2 自定义菜单
微信公众平台提供了自定义菜单的功能,通过自定义菜单,可以实现微信公众号与外部网页的链接,从而获取和显示外部数据。在自定义菜单中,可以添加点击事件,当用户点击菜单时,可以跳转到外部链接,并将微信用户的相关信息传递给外部链接的网页。在外部网页中,可以通过调用接口获取外部数据,并在微信公众号中展示。
二、使用微信小程序
2.1 接入小程序
微信小程序是一种基于微信公众平台的应用,支持自定义界面和功能的轻应用。通过在微信公众平台注册小程序,并将其与微信公众号关联,可以在微信公众号中嵌入小程序,从而实现微信公众号与外部数据源的接入。在小程序中,可以通过调用接口获取外部数据,并在微信公众号中展示和使用。
2.2 调用云开发
微信小程序的云开发是一种支持开发者在小程序端进行云端开发的平台,可以直接访问和管理云端数据库。通过在微信小程序中使用云开发,可以将外部数据源的数据存储在云端数据库,并在微信公众号中通过调用云开发接口获取和展示数据。同时,云开发还提供了云函数和云存储等功能,方便开发者对数据进行逻辑处理和存储管理。
三、数据接口对接
3.1 数据对接接口
有些外部数据源可能提供了数据对接接口,通过对接接口,可以实现数据的获取和使用。在微信公众号中,可以调用外部数据源提供的接口,将其返回的数据展示在文章中或通过模板消息发送给用户。数据对接接口的对接过程需要根据具体的接口文档进行开发和配置。
3.2 数据格式转换
在接入外部数据源时,有时需要对数据的格式进行转换。有些外部数据源返回的数据格式可能与微信公众号的要求不一致,为了能够正常展示和使用数据,需要将数据进行格式转换。可以通过编写中间层服务或脚本来实现数据格式的转换,将外部数据源的数据进行解析和处理,然后将符合要求的数据返回给微信公众号。
在实际应用中,根据具体的需求和场景,可以选择适合的方法来实现微信公众号与外部数据源的接入。通过接入外部数据源,可以丰富微信公众号的功能和内容,提升用户体验,满足用户的个性化需求。但同时也需要注意数据的安全性和合规性,确保数据的使用符合相关法规和用户协议。通过合理和有效地接入外部数据源,可以提升微信公众号的价值和应用范围,实现更多的商业价值。
发布者:微信解封平台,转转请注明出处:https://www.eryiw.com/7019.html